Output 1278089f645ee43b3cb26448c19558af1fbb2e2c8f10603ebc77e5651bf19622:8

value
1301676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e27d3d7d9c1885a8a8fba5de80dc83f2ceadd7 OP_EQUAL
address
3H5zmX1DBNeqq5ykqFtwmbVGyKPyXAZWic
transaction
1278089f645ee43b3cb26448c19558af1fbb2e2c8f10603ebc77e5651bf19622
confirmations
2758
spent
true